Black Caviar Lightning Stakes: Star mare saunters to success

Black Caviar produced a superb performance

Trainer Peter Moody admitted he "was lost for words" after Black Caviar extended her unbeaten record to 23 in a race named in her honour at Flemington...

The astounding sprinter broke the track record with an exceptional comeback performance in the Group 1 Black Caviar Lightning Stakes. It was her first run since she claimed a dramatic victory in the Diamond Jubilee Stakes at Royal Ascot in June.

Although the great mare's racing career had been in the balance following her exertions in England, Black Caviar made a seamless return to the track by defeating Moment Of Change by two and a half lengths.

Peter Moody said: "I am proud to have her back. We were on a hiding to nothing by bringing her back. I think it was the first time I've been nervous for a long time - I suppose it was the seven-month break - but I'm just so proud of her."
